It shows how well you are controlling your blood sugar to help prevent … medication tramadol side effectsWebCGM devices are made of three parts: a sensor to detect interstitial glucose that is inserted subcutaneously by the patient or health care professional, a receiver or reader that displays the... nachos fine authentic mexican cuisineWebThe results showed that the accuracy of A1CNow+, with fingerstick samples was, on average, 99%. This means that, on average, a true 7.0% A1C could read approximately 6.9% A1C. An individual A1CNow+ result may differ by as much as -1.0% A1C to +0.8% A1C from the true result. This represents the 95% confidence limits of a Bland-Altman plot.2 medication training online free ukWebJan 6, 2024 · The higher the level of glucose in the blood, the higher the level of hemoglobin A1c is detectable on red blood cells.
